#import "ListController.h"
#import "NetworkManager.h"
#include <sys/socket.h>
#include <sys/dirent.h>
#include <CFNetwork/CFNetwork.h>
#pragma mark * ListController
@interface ListController () <UITextFieldDelegate, UITableViewDelegate, UITableViewDataSource, NSStreamDelegate>
// thinsg for IB
@property (nonatomic, strong, readwrite) IBOutlet UITextField * urlText;
@property (nonatomic, strong, readwrite) IBOutlet UIActivityIndicatorView * activityIndicator;
@property (nonatomic, strong, readwrite) IBOutlet UITableView * tableView;
@property (nonatomic, strong, readwrite) IBOutlet UIBarButtonItem * listOrCancelButton;
- (IBAction)listOrCancelAction:(id)sender;
// Properties that don't need to be seen by the outside world.
@property (nonatomic, assign, readonly ) BOOL isReceiving;
@property (nonatomic, strong, readwrite) NSInputStream * networkStream;
@property (nonatomic, strong, readwrite) NSMutableData * listData;
@property (nonatomic, strong, readwrite) NSMutableArray * listEntries;
@property (nonatomic, copy, readwrite) NSString * status;
- (void)updateStatus:(NSString *)statusString;
@end
@implementation ListController
@synthesize urlText = _urlText;
@synthesize activityIndicator = _activityIndicator;
@synthesize tableView = _tableView;
@synthesize listOrCancelButton = _listOrCancelButton;
@synthesize status = _status;
@synthesize networkStream = _networkStream;
@synthesize listData = _listData;
@synthesize listEntries = _listEntries;
#pragma mark * Status management
// These methods are used by the core transfer code to update the UI.
- (void)receiveDidStart
{
// Clear the current image so that we get a nice visual cue if the receive fails.
[self.listEntries removeAllObjects];
[self.tableView reloadData];
[self updateStatus:@"Receiving"];
self.listOrCancelButton.title = @"Cancel";
[self.activityIndicator startAnimating];
[[NetworkManager sharedInstance] didStartNetworkOperation];
}
- (void)updateStatus:(NSString *)statusString
{
assert(statusString != nil);
self.status = statusString;
[self.tableView reloadRowsAtIndexPaths:[NSArray arrayWithObject:[NSIndexPath indexPathForRow:0 inSection:0]] withRowAnimation:UITableViewRowAnimationNone];
}
- (void)addListEntries:(NSArray *)newEntries
{
assert(self.listEntries != nil);
[self.listEntries addObjectsFromArray:newEntries];
[self.tableView reloadData];
}
- (void)receiveDidStopWithStatus:(NSString *)statusString
{
if (statusString == nil) {
statusString = @"List succeeded";
}
[self updateStatus:statusString];
self.listOrCancelButton.title = @"List";
[self.activityIndicator stopAnimating];
[[NetworkManager sharedInstance] didStopNetworkOperation];
}
#pragma mark * Core transfer code
// This is the code that actually does the networking.
- (BOOL)isReceiving
{
return (self.networkStream != nil);
}
- (void)startReceive
// Starts a connection to download the current URL.
{
BOOL success;
NSURL * url;
assert(self.networkStream == nil); // don't tap receive twice in a row!
// First get and check the URL.
url = [[NetworkManager sharedInstance] smartURLForString:self.urlText.text];
success = (url != nil);
// If the URL is bogus, let the user know. Otherwise kick off the connection.
if ( ! success) {
[self updateStatus:@"Invalid URL"];
} else {
// Create the mutable data into which we will receive the listing.
self.listData = [NSMutableData data];
assert(self.listData != nil);
// Open a CFFTPStream for the URL.
self.networkStream = CFBridgingRelease(
CFReadStreamCreateWithFTPURL(NULL, (__bridge CFURLRef) url)
);
assert(self.networkStream != nil);
self.networkStream.delegate = self;
[self.networkStream scheduleInRunLoop:[NSRunLoop currentRunLoop] forMode:NSDefaultRunLoopMode];
[self.networkStream open];
// Tell the UI we're receiving.
[self receiveDidStart];
}
}
- (void)stopReceiveWithStatus:(NSString *)statusString
// Shuts down the connection and displays the result (statusString == nil)
// or the error status (otherwise).
{
if (self.networkStream != nil) {
[self.networkStream removeFromRunLoop:[NSRunLoop currentRunLoop] forMode:NSDefaultRunLoopMode];
self.networkStream.delegate = nil;
[self.networkStream close];
self.networkStream = nil;
}
[self receiveDidStopWithStatus:statusString];
self.listData = nil;
}
- (NSDictionary *)entryByReencodingNameInEntry:(NSDictionary *)entry encoding:(NSStringEncoding)newEncoding
// CFFTPCreateParsedResourceListing always interprets the file name as MacRoman,
// which is clearly bogus <rdar://problem/7420589>. This code attempts to fix
// that by converting the Unicode name back to MacRoman (to get the original bytes;
// this works because there's a lossless round trip between MacRoman and Unicode)
// and then reconverting those bytes to Unicode using the encoding provided.
{
NSDictionary * result;
NSString * name;
NSData * nameData;
NSString * newName;
newName = nil;
// Try to get the name, convert it back to MacRoman, and then reconvert it
// with the preferred encoding.
name = [entry objectForKey:(id) kCFFTPResourceName];
if (name != nil) {
assert([name isKindOfClass:[NSString class]]);
nameData = [name dataUsingEncoding:NSMacOSRomanStringEncoding];
if (nameData != nil) {
newName = [[NSString alloc] initWithData:nameData encoding:newEncoding];
}
}
// If the above failed, just return the entry unmodified. If it succeeded,
// make a copy of the entry and replace the name with the new name that we
// calculated.
if (newName == nil) {
assert(NO); // in the debug builds, if this fails, we should investigate why
result = (NSDictionary *) entry;
} else {
NSMutableDictionary * newEntry;
newEntry = [entry mutableCopy];
assert(newEntry != nil);
[newEntry setObject:newName forKey:(id) kCFFTPResourceName];
result = newEntry;
}
return result;
}
- (void)parseListData
{
NSMutableArray * newEntries;
NSUInteger offset;
// We accumulate the new entries into an array to avoid a) adding items to the
// table one-by-one, and b) repeatedly shuffling the listData buffer around.
newEntries = [NSMutableArray array];
assert(newEntries != nil);
offset = 0;
do {
CFIndex bytesConsumed;
CFDictionaryRef thisEntry;
thisEntry = NULL;
assert(offset <= [self.listData length]);
bytesConsumed = CFFTPCreateParsedResourceListing(NULL, &((const uint8_t *) self.listData.bytes)[offset], (CFIndex) ([self.listData length] - offset), &thisEntry);
if (bytesConsumed > 0) {
// It is possible for CFFTPCreateParsedResourceListing to return a
// positive number but not create a parse dictionary. For example,
// if the end of the listing text contains stuff that can't be parsed,
// CFFTPCreateParsedResourceListing returns a positive number (to tell
// the caller that it has consumed the data), but doesn't create a parse
// dictionary (because it couldn't make sense of the data). So, it's
// important that we check for NULL.
if (thisEntry != NULL) {
NSDictionary * entryToAdd;
// Try to interpret the name as UTF-8, which makes things work properly
// with many UNIX-like systems, including the Mac OS X built-in FTP
// server. If you have some idea what type of text your target system
// is going to return, you could tweak this encoding. For example,
// if you know that the target system is running Windows, then
// NSWindowsCP1252StringEncoding would be a good choice here.
//
// Alternatively you could let the user choose the encoding up
// front, or reencode the listing after they've seen it and decided
// it's wrong.
//
// Ain't FTP a wonderful protocol!
entryToAdd = [self entryByReencodingNameInEntry:(__bridge NSDictionary *) thisEntry encoding:NSUTF8StringEncoding];
[newEntries addObject:entryToAdd];
}
// We consume the bytes regardless of whether we get an entry.
offset += (NSUInteger) bytesConsumed;
}
if (thisEntry != NULL) {
CFRelease(thisEntry);
}
if (bytesConsumed == 0) {
// We haven't yet got enough data to parse an entry. Wait for more data
// to arrive.
break;
} else if (bytesConsumed < 0) {
// We totally failed to parse the listing. Fail.
[self stopReceiveWithStatus:@"Listing parse failed"];
break;
}
} while (YES);
if ([newEntries count] != 0) {
[self addListEntries:newEntries];
}
if (offset != 0) {
[self.listData replaceBytesInRange:NSMakeRange(0, offset) withBytes:NULL length:0];
}
}
- (void)stream:(NSStream *)aStream handleEvent:(NSStreamEvent)eventCode
// An NSStream delegate callback that's called when events happen on our
// network stream.
{
#pragma unused(aStream)
assert(aStream == self.networkStream);
switch (eventCode) {
case NSStreamEventOpenCompleted: {
[self updateStatus:@"Opened connection"];
} break;
case NSStreamEventHasBytesAvailable: {
NSInteger bytesRead;
uint8_t buffer[32768];
[self updateStatus:@"Receiving"];
// Pull some data off the network.
bytesRead = [self.networkStream read:buffer maxLength:sizeof(buffer)];
if (bytesRead < 0) {
[self stopReceiveWithStatus:@"Network read error"];
} else if (bytesRead == 0) {
[self stopReceiveWithStatus:nil];
} else {
assert(self.listData != nil);
// Append the data to our listing buffer.
[self.listData appendBytes:buffer length:(NSUInteger) bytesRead];
// Check the listing buffer for any complete entries and update
// the UI if we find any.
[self parseListData];
}
} break;
case NSStreamEventHasSpaceAvailable: {
assert(NO); // should never happen for the output stream
} break;
case NSStreamEventErrorOccurred: {
[self stopReceiveWithStatus:@"Stream open error"];
} break;
case NSStreamEventEndEncountered: {
// ignore
} break;
default: {
assert(NO);
} break;
}
}
#pragma mark * UI actions
- (IBAction)listOrCancelAction:(id)sender
{
#pragma unused(sender)
if (self.isReceiving) {
[self stopReceiveWithStatus:@"Cancelled"];
} else {
[self startReceive];
}
}
- (void)textFieldDidEndEditing:(UITextField *)textField
// A delegate method called by the URL text field when the editing is complete.
// We save the current value of the field in our settings.
{
#pragma unused(textField)
NSString * newValue;
NSString * oldValue;
assert(textField == self.urlText);
newValue = self.urlText.text;
oldValue = [[NSUserDefaults standardUserDefaults] stringForKey:@"ListURLText"];
// Save the URL text if it's changed.
assert(newValue != nil); // what is UITextField thinking!?!
assert(oldValue != nil); // because we registered a default
if ( ! [newValue isEqual:oldValue] ) {
[[NSUserDefaults standardUserDefaults] setObject:newValue forKey:@"ListURLText"];
}
}
- (BOOL)textFieldShouldReturn:(UITextField *)textField
// A delegate method called by the URL text field when the user taps the Return
// key. We just dismiss the keyboard.
{
#pragma unused(textField)
assert(textField == self.urlText);
[self.urlText resignFirstResponder];
return NO;
}
#pragma mark * Table view data source and delegate
- (NSInteger)tableView:(UITableView *)tv numberOfRowsInSection:(NSInteger)section
{
#pragma unused(tv)
#pragma unused(section)
assert(tv == self.tableView);
assert(section == 0);
return (NSInteger) ([self.listEntries count] + 1);
}
- (NSString *)stringForNumber:(double)num asUnits:(NSString *)units
{
NSString * result;
double fractional;
double integral;
fractional = modf(num, &integral);
if ( (fractional < 0.1) || (fractional > 0.9) ) {
result = [NSString stringWithFormat:@"%.0f %@", round(num), units];
} else {
result = [NSString stringWithFormat:@"%.1f %@", num, units];
}
return result;
}
- (NSString *)stringForFileSize:(unsigned long long)fileSizeExact
{
double fileSize;
NSString * result;
fileSize = (double) fileSizeExact;
if (fileSizeExact == 1) {
result = @"1 byte";
} else if (fileSizeExact < 1024) {
result = [NSString stringWithFormat:@"%llu bytes", fileSizeExact];
} else if (fileSize < (1024.0 * 1024.0 * 0.1)) {
result = [self stringForNumber:fileSize / 1024.0 asUnits:@"KB"];
} else if (fileSize < (1024.0 * 1024.0 * 1024.0 * 0.1)) {
result = [self stringForNumber:fileSize / (1024.0 * 1024.0) asUnits:@"MB"];
} else {
result = [self stringForNumber:fileSize / (1024.0 * 1024.0 * 1024.0) asUnits:@"MB"];
}
return result;
}
static NSDateFormatter * sDateFormatter;
- (UITableViewCell *)tableView:(UITableView *)tv cellForRowAtIndexPath:(NSIndexPath *)indexPath
{
UITableViewCell * cell;
NSDictionary * listEntry;
NSNumber * typeNum;
int type;
NSNumber * sizeNum;
NSString * sizeStr;
NSNumber * modeNum;
char modeCStr[12];
NSDate * date;
NSString * dateStr;
#pragma unused(tv)
assert(tv == self.tableView);
assert(indexPath != nil);
assert(indexPath.section == 0);
assert(indexPath.row >= 0);
assert( (NSUInteger) indexPath.row < ([self.listEntries count] + 1));
if (indexPath.row == 0) {
cell = [self.tableView dequeueReusableCellWithIdentifier:@"StatusCell"];
if (cell == nil) {
cell = [[UITableViewCell alloc] initWithStyle:UITableViewCellStyleDefault reuseIdentifier:@"StatusCell"];
}
assert(cell != nil);
cell.textLabel.text = self.status;
cell.textLabel.font = [UIFont systemFontOfSize:17.0f];
cell.textLabel.textAlignment = UITextAlignmentCenter;
} else {
cell = [self.tableView dequeueReusableCellWithIdentifier:@"ListCell"];
if (cell == nil) {
cell = [[UITableViewCell alloc] initWithStyle:UITableViewCellStyleSubtitle reuseIdentifier:@"ListCell"];
}
assert(cell != nil);
listEntry = [self.listEntries objectAtIndex:((NSUInteger) indexPath.row) - 1];
assert([listEntry isKindOfClass:[NSDictionary class]]);
// The first line of the cell is the item name.
cell.textLabel.text = [listEntry objectForKey:(id) kCFFTPResourceName];
// Use the second line of the cell to show various attributes.
typeNum = [listEntry objectForKey:(id) kCFFTPResourceType];
if (typeNum != nil) {
assert([typeNum isKindOfClass:[NSNumber class]]);
type = [typeNum intValue];
} else {
type = 0;
}
modeNum = [listEntry objectForKey:(id) kCFFTPResourceMode];
if (modeNum != nil) {
assert([modeNum isKindOfClass:[NSNumber class]]);
strmode([modeNum intValue] + DTTOIF(type), modeCStr);
} else {
strlcat(modeCStr, "???????????", sizeof(modeCStr));
}
sizeNum = [listEntry objectForKey:(id) kCFFTPResourceSize];
if (sizeNum != nil) {
if (type == DT_REG) {
assert([sizeNum isKindOfClass:[NSNumber class]]);
sizeStr = [self stringForFileSize:[sizeNum unsignedLongLongValue]];
} else {
sizeStr = @"-";
}
} else {
sizeStr = @"?";
}
date = [listEntry objectForKey:(id) kCFFTPResourceModDate];
if (date != nil) {
if (sDateFormatter == nil) {
sDateFormatter = [[NSDateFormatter alloc] init];
assert(sDateFormatter != nil);
sDateFormatter.dateStyle = NSDateFormatterShortStyle;
sDateFormatter.timeStyle = NSDateFormatterShortStyle;
}
dateStr = [sDateFormatter stringFromDate:date];
} else {
dateStr = @"";
}
cell.detailTextLabel.text = [NSString stringWithFormat:@"%s %@ %@", modeCStr, sizeStr, dateStr];
}
cell.selectionStyle = UITableViewCellSelectionStyleNone;
return cell;
}
#pragma mark * View controller boilerplate
- (void)viewDidLoad
{
[super viewDidLoad];
assert(self.urlText != nil);
assert(self.activityIndicator != nil);
assert(self.tableView != nil);
assert(self.listOrCancelButton != nil);
self.listOrCancelButton.possibleTitles = [NSSet setWithObjects:@"List", @"Cancel", nil];
if (self.listEntries == nil) {
self.listEntries = [NSMutableArray array];
assert(self.listEntries != nil);
}
self.urlText.text = [[NSUserDefaults standardUserDefaults] stringForKey:@"ListURLText"];
self.activityIndicator.hidden = YES;
[self updateStatus:@"Tap a picture to start listing"];
}
- (void)viewDidUnload
{
[super viewDidUnload];
self.urlText = nil;
self.activityIndicator = nil;
self.tableView = nil;
self.listOrCancelButton = nil;
}
- (void)dealloc
{
[self stopReceiveWithStatus:@"Stopped"];
}
@end
